John of Patmos wrote the Bible's most unusual book after he was exiled by the ancient Romans.
High on the slopes of Mount Parnassus, the sanctuary of Delphi was the most famous oracle of the ancient world, a priestess of the Greek god Apollo, who could shape the course of history.
